上一篇文章寫了cinder服務的啟動,下面講一下openstack是如何通過openstack創建一個卷 通過查看cinder的api-paste.ini文件,並且現在是v3版本的API,可以得知目前API的router文件是cinder/api/v3/router.py文件 ...
比較忙,很長世間沒空看openstack源碼,抽時間看了一下cinder的源碼,貼下學習心得。本文簡單寫一下cinder的三個服務的啟動,cinder api, cinder scheduler, 以及cinder volume,三者啟動都差不多 cinder api 入口文件為 usr bin cinder api,由此可知,入口為cinder.cmd.api文件中的main函數 main函數如 ...
2020-01-02 19:35 0 780 推薦指數:
上一篇文章寫了cinder服務的啟動,下面講一下openstack是如何通過openstack創建一個卷 通過查看cinder的api-paste.ini文件,並且現在是v3版本的API,可以得知目前API的router文件是cinder/api/v3/router.py文件 ...
一、cinder 介紹: 理解 Block Storage 操作系統 獲得存儲空間的方式一般有兩種: 通過某種協議(SAS,SCSI,SAN,iSCSI 等) 掛接裸硬盤,然后分區、格式化、創建文件系統;或者直接使用裸硬盤 ...
一、cinder 介紹: 理解 Block Storage ...
本文分享openstack的Cinder存儲服務組件,cinder服務可以提供雲磁盤(卷),類似阿里雲雲盤 ----------------------- 完美的分隔線 ----------------------------- # openstack-Mitaka-cinder塊存儲服務 ...
OpenStack Block Storage服務(Cinder)將持久存儲添加到虛擬機。塊存儲提供用於管理卷的基礎結構,並與OpenStack Compute交互以為實例提供卷。該服務還可以管理卷快照和卷類型。 塊存儲服務包含以下組件: cinderAPI 接受API ...
初學:塊存儲服務cinder cinder 概述 它是一個資源管理系統,負責向虛機提供持久塊存儲資源 把不同的后端存儲進行封裝,向外提供一個api 它是以插件的方式,結合不同后端存儲驅動提供塊存儲服務,主要負責 對卷處理 對卷的類型處理 卷的快照處理 ...
一、塊存儲服務cinder的介紹 1. 塊存儲cinder概覽 塊存儲服務(cinder)為實例提供塊存儲。存儲的分配和消耗是由塊存儲驅動器,或者多后端配置的驅動器決定的。還有很多驅動程序可用:NAS/SAN,NFS,LVM,Ceph等。 OpenStack塊存儲服務(cinder ...
Cinder采用的是松散的架構理念,由cinder-api統一管理外部對cinder的調用,cinder-scheduler負責調度合適的節點去構建volume存儲。volume-provider通過driver負責具體的存儲空間,然后cinder內部依舊通過消息隊列queue溝通,解耦各子 ...